#14341f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#14341f is composed of 7.8% red, 20.4%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.4% yellow and 79.6% black. It has a hue angle of 140.6 degrees, a saturation of 44.4% and a lightness of 14.1%. #14341f color hex could be obtained by blending #28683e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#14341f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a06 is the darkest color, while #fafdfb is the lightest one.
